Indonesia possesses a unique demographic formula that makes it a fertile ground for online video consumption. With a population exceeding 280 million people, the nation boasts a median age of approximately 30 years old. This hyper-connected youth demographic spends an average of over 3 to 4 hours per day on social media, significantly higher than the global average.
Food is a central pillar of Indonesian culture. Popular videos often feature creators traveling to remote villages or bustling night markets ( pasar malam ) to highlight street food. Indonesian mukbang (eating broadcasts) features a local twist: ultra-spicy sambal challenges. The massive viewership numbers have translated into a robust creator economy. Brands have shifted substantial advertising budgets from traditional television networks to digital video campaigns. Hyper-localized influencer marketing is now standard practice, with brands leveraging micro-influencers who speak local dialects (such as Javanese, Sundanese, or Balinese) to build authentic consumer trust.
The epicenter of trend creation. TikTok is where local slang is born, music hits are made, and micro-trends scale nationally. The integration of TikTok Shop (and its partnerships) has turned popular videos directly into live-stream e-commerce powerhouses.
While global giants like Netflix and Disney+ Hotstar exist, the homegrown hero is . As the leading Over-The-Top (OTT) platform in Indonesia, Vidio has cracked the code for local premium content. They produce exclusive Web Series that are grittier, shorter, and more daring than traditional television. Hits like My Nerd Girl and Scandal 2 have shown that Indonesians will pay for high-production, locally relevant storytelling—provided it is accessible on their phones.
To understand the current digital craze, one must first acknowledge the traditional pillars of Indonesian entertainment. For generations, sinetron (soap operas) ruled the airwaves. These dramas, often characterized by melodramatic plotlines, themes of social stratification, and Islamic moral values, established the template for mass appeal. Concurrently, the music industry, particularly Dangdut (a fusion of Malay folk music, Indian influences, and Arabic sounds), served as the rhythmic heartbeat of the working class. While Pop Indonesia catered to the urban youth, Dangdut remained the undisputed king of cross-democratic appeal. These formats laid the groundwork for what would become a key feature of Indonesian entertainment: a strong reliance on relatability and emotional resonance.
